How can companies build customer-centric, future-proof business models in an age of AI while scaling across markets and channels and making sustainability a genuine source of customer value?

Since its launch in 2017, waterdrop® has grown from an Austrian start-up built around a small hydration cube into a €126 million global business spanning e-commerce, its own stores, retail partners and marketplaces. In this INTHECASE webinar, INSEAD Professor Joerg Niessing will be joined by Martin Murray (MBA’15D), Founder and CEO of waterdrop®, and Tina Scheele (MBA’02J), customer strategy expert and former Partner at Monitor Deloitte.

Using waterdrop® as the starting point, they will explore the broader lessons for both challengers and established companies: how to connect physical and digital experiences, use data and AI to reimagine customer engagement and personalization, evolve from products towards ecosystems and new business models and turn sustainability from a corporate ambition into meaningful customer value.
